Mood Chocolate: The Ultimate Sweet Treat for Enhancing Emotional Well-being

Mood chocolate, often referred to as 'mood chocolates,' is a unique type of confection that has gained popularity for its potential to positively influence one's mood and overall sense of well-being. These chocolates are crafted with natural ingredients, including adaptogens and essential oils, which are believed to promote relaxation, stress relief, and a heightened sense of happiness and well-being.

Mind-Enhancing Ingredients

Mood chocolate is typically infused with a blend of natural ingredients that are believed to positively impact mental and emotional health. The most common active ingredients in mood chocolate include:

  • Adaptogens: Non-toxic plants such as rhodiola rosea, ashwagandha (withania somnifera), and holy basil (ocimum sanctum). These adaptogens help to support the body's stress response by regulating neurotransmitter function and hormone levels, ultimately leading to reduced feelings of stress and improved mental clarity.
  • Herbs: Many mood chocolates contain a blend of herbs, such as lavender, chamomile, and rose, which are known for their calming and soothing properties. These herbs can help to promote relaxation and reduce feelings of anxiety by interacting with the body's stress response systems.
  • Spices: Ginger, cinnamon, and other warming spices are often added to mood chocolate to enhance its mood-lifting effects. These spices have been used for centuries in traditional medicine to alleviate nausea, improve digestion, and boost circulation, among other benefits.

Safety and Side Effects

As with any dietary supplement, it is important to consult with a healthcare provider before incorporating mood chocolate into your diet, especially if you have any underlying medical conditions or are taking prescription medications. While mood chocolate is generally considered safe for most individuals, some people may experience adverse reactions, such as increased heartburn or gastrointestinal discomfort. Additionally, individuals with a nut allergy should avoid consuming mood chocolate due to the potential contamination with nuts from the production process.
